Thorpe Park Mardi Gras 2022 Review

Are you ready for a party like no other? Thorpe Park Resort have introduced a brand new event, Mardi Gras! Turning the temperature up with exhilarating rides, Louisiana vibes and authentic street food, this celebration is one not to be missed this spring. 

Mardi Gras runs from the 19th May to the 19th June 2022. Throughout these dates, the park has different opening hours between 10am – 5pm, 10am – 6pm and even 10am – 7pm! Each day offers more entertainment than usual across the resort, with the main hub being located throughout deep in the park around Detonator, Nemesis Inferno & Teacups.

You’ll even find more food options than usual at the resort, with several additional food stands alongside special treats at some of the other outlets! 

What makes this all even better is that it is all included with your park ticket & annual pass entry, no extra charges. The event may not be for you? No problems, just continue your day enjoying the rides you love.

With so much entertainment going on at Mardi Gras, there is enough to see throughout your day. Starting off on the main stage, you have the main show called Crowning of the Krewes, a 15 minute singing, dancing and rap performance from the 4 different Krewes at the resort. These being Nemesina, Rift Racers, Rapid Rhymer & Aqueous, all themed to rides & attractions across the resort. Each having a song to perform to the public before the Royals request your votes to decide the winner and crown! 

Other stage shows include the Fat Brass Jazz Band that’ll play popular chart music that you know in their funky jazz style and the Drum Works Community Band, which will keep the vibe going with their infectious music.

The smaller stage outside Nemesis Inferno will also feature some music performances from different acts throughout the event!

If the stage shows were not enough, they have even more entertainment throughout the Mardi Gras hub area. A Street Parade happens multiple times a day which includes the full Mardi Gras team, which party their way from Depth Charge through to Nemesis Inferno. Whilst short, it had a great vibe and atmosphere as they passed by. 

Outside the back of Burger King and by Rumba Rapids / Teacups, there is an area with some pumping music can be enjoyed. Whilst usually a dead area at the park, this allows a place to chill and party. The parade also crosses this area, so a perfect quiet place to spot them! 

The Mardi Gras Krewes were also out roaming in full force during our visit, and they can met for meet and greets, as well as they were partying in several different areas. The Royals were perfect with their interactions with all guests and looked like they had so much fun!

It wouldn’t be a Mardi Gras event without some food. The New Orleans has some very unique twists to the UK food and the event brings some snacks you wouldn’t of expected to see, especially at Thorpe Park! Crocodile burgers, Po Boys, and even a Rainbow Donut are just some of the food now on offer. If you fancy some meat, then you can try the Crocodile burger, or maybe a Buffalo burger? They have Louisiana Ribs and that is just Thorpe Park getting started. Cajun fries and Chipotle Chicken Pizza, it feels the list does not stop. They even have sweet treats such as the Mardi Gras Cake, Rainbow Donuts or just even a Cupcake! 

Most of this food can be found in the Mardi Gras Hub, with new street food stalls being setup just outside Angry Bird Land. Peckish & Sombrero’s also have some treats you can find. A food & drink stand is also opposite the teacups to provide even more options, as well a new bar so you don’t have to go far for a beverage!

Thorpe Park Resort have also added some theming across the resort for Mardi Gras. It adds some colour to the the resort as well it completes the atmosphere. Fancy some merch? Then Thorpe have you covered with a t-shirt, mug and pin badge all themed for the event. 

The whole Mardi Gras event is one of the best events Thorpe Park have put in on recent years. The whole resort comes alive with such a happy, colourful and vibrant atmosphere which is infectious for everyone. The additional entertainment adds to your typical day and these shows and characters are great fillers inbetween the rides & attractions.
